Omlet Arcade connects gamers with real-time social interaction
Omlet Arcade, developed by Omlet Inc, served as a real-time social platform designed specifically for gamers to connect, chat, and explore gaming communities worldwide. It focused on building interactive experiences by allowing users to watch live streams, engage in conversations, and discover new games. The app prioritized social connectivity and provided a dynamic hub for players seeking to share tips, memes, and commentary within gamer networks.
A social network built around gaming communities
Omlet Arcade functioned as a centralized environment where gamers were able to easily chat with friends and join broader communities. This networking aspect emphasized genuine interaction and encouraged users to bond over shared interests and game knowledge. The platform supported the exchange of gameplay tips and secrets, which helped build relationships beyond typical play sessions. Users encountered a varied social experience that merged live streaming with message-based communication, fostering ongoing engagement with like-minded peers. The social platform had both a free tier and a premium subscription tier called Omlet Plus, where features like unlimited multi-streaming to multiple platforms were supported, as well as 1080p streaming.
Real-time streaming and discovery for an engaged audience
The social platform centered on real-time video streaming and game discovery, offering users a way to watch live content and find new titles to explore. One standout functionality of Omlet Arcade was the ability to download game maps, which enhanced exploration and customization during play. However, user experiences encountered some obstacles, including inconsistent streaming speeds that interfered with live broadcasts and occasional bugs in the stream recording function that disrupted content capture. These factors affected the overall reliability and smoothness of performance.
